Master-detail raises Do you want to save changes
Dear all,
my form is of 1 master block and 3 details to that block, now whenever i tried to exit the form a Do you want to save changes? message is displayed but whenever i delete any one of the relations the message doesn't appear..
plz any help is appreciated
The problem is that some of the records are marjed as dirty - If you're not actually changing anything manually and you still get the error, then check that you've not got any POST-QUERY triggers updating DB fields or the use of LOV for validation which can also mark a record as dirty.
You can of course supress / ignore the DYWTC message using EXIT_FORM(NO_VALIDATE) or similar, but you'lll probaly want to double check the cause of the record update first.

Do you want to save changes - appears twice in master-detail form.
Hello.
Sometimes ago i wanted "Do you want to save changes" message in my own language.
So i created trigger:
if :system.form_status IN ('CHANGED') then
alert_response := show_alert('CHANGES');
if alert_response = alert_button1 then
commit_form;
elsif alert_response = alert_button2 then
clear_block(no_commit);
elsif alert_response = alert_button3 then
raise form_trigger_failure;
end if;
end if;
I call that trigger in many other triggers like enter_query, ...
Everything worked fine until i created form with master_detail block.
The problem:
I have a form with two blocks. One master, one detail.
If i change something in detail block, go to master block item and press enter_query problem appears.
First i get the message "Do you ..." in my language. When i press NO or CANCEL i get again the message "Do you ..." in original (english) language?
Why is that?
Should i call my trigger somewhere else and not just in enter_query trigger (for this problem) or is checking form_status not enough?
Thanks.When you create relation, 3 procedures are automatically created for you.
Check_Package_Failure, Clear_All_Master_Details and Query_Master_Details.
When you execute clear_block(no_commit) on the master block -
Clear_All_Master_Details will fire.
If you check Clear_All_Master_Details you will find following code there:
Go_Block(curblk);
Check_Package_Failure;
Clear_Block(ASK_COMMIT); -- This statement causing "Do you want to save changes" to appear -

How to enforce the message "Do you want to save changes?"
Hello,
How to enforce the message "Do you want to save changes?" when the user attempts to close a form after checking a non-database item (check-box).
All the other database items in the block are not updateable and only viewable.
After checking the non database item check-box, if the user tries to commit, then the system is saving the changes and call the appropriate procedure on save.
But if the user tries to close the window without committing, the form is not showing the message "Do you want to save changes?" since the check-box is a non database item.
How to enforce the message "Do you want to save changes?" in this scenario when the user tries to close the window?
Thanks in advance.
Cheers
SriThis is a fairly common question in the forum. You will need to override the default exit form process and check to see if the checkbox is checked. You can do this in the Key-Exit trigger. For Example:
DECLARE
al_id ALERT;
al_button NUMBER;
BEGIN
IF ( CHECKBOX_CHECKED('YOUR_BLOCK.CHECKBOX_ITEM') ) THEN
/* Display an Alert here that asks, "Do you want to save changes?" */
...code here to set the properties of your alert...
al_button := Show_Alert(al_id);
IF ( al_button = ALERT_BUTTON1 ) THEN
--YES
/* Perform COMMIT Processing here...*/
ELSIF ( al_button = ALERT_BUTTON2 ) THEN
--No
Exit_Form(NO_VALIDATE);
ELSE
--Cancel
RAISE Form_Trigger_Failure;
END IF;
ELSE
Exit_Form;
END IF;
END;If you need more help with the Alert, please check out the SHOW_ALERT topic in the Forms Help.
BTW, what happens if all the user does is check the checkbox? No other changes have occured. What changes are you trying to process?

How do I stop pop up that asks me, Do you want to save changes to doc... before closing? I have made no changes only printed the file. Using Adobe Reader DC, Windows 7 64 bit.
This is very annoying and we need this stopped as we have made no changes to any of the adobe files. Please advise how to do this.
Customer Service DCCI first tried the version without the deflated stream (so everything uncompressed) against the online repair tool to check/analyse it @ https://www.pdf-tools.com/osa/repair.aspx
And it says no error found, but the reader still want to save it when closing so i still had no clue at this point.
Fortunately, i finally found what was wrong with my generated PDF.
In my xref table, each object reference was not end by a full EOL, i only did put a newline char.
Now i have "carriage return" "newline" which is the full EOL and the reader is happy and close the file silently.
As suspected i did not follow correctly the specs on xref table
Now i'll go and figure what i did wrong with the deflate filter
